首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Anaconda环境而不激活源代码

Anaconda是一个开源的Python和R编程语言的发行版,用于科学计算、数据分析和机器学习等领域。它包含了许多常用的科学计算和数据分析库,如NumPy、Pandas、Matplotlib等,并提供了一个集成的开发环境。

使用Anaconda环境而不激活源代码意味着在使用Anaconda时,不需要手动激活Anaconda环境,而是直接使用Anaconda提供的命令和工具进行开发。

优势:

  1. 简化环境配置:Anaconda提供了一个集成的环境,包含了许多常用的科学计算和数据分析库,避免了用户手动安装和配置这些库的麻烦。
  2. 跨平台支持:Anaconda可以在多个操作系统上运行,包括Windows、Linux和macOS,使得开发者可以在不同的平台上进行开发和部署。
  3. 管理依赖关系:Anaconda使用conda包管理器来管理软件包的依赖关系,可以方便地安装、更新和卸载各种库,避免了依赖冲突和版本不兼容的问题。
  4. 虚拟环境支持:Anaconda支持创建和管理虚拟环境,可以在不同的项目中使用不同的环境,避免了不同项目之间的依赖冲突。
  5. 社区支持:Anaconda拥有庞大的用户社区和开发者社区,可以获取到丰富的文档、教程和示例代码,解决开发过程中遇到的问题。

应用场景:

  1. 数据分析和可视化:Anaconda提供了丰富的数据分析和可视化库,可以用于处理和分析大规模数据,并通过图表和图形展示数据结果。
  2. 机器学习和深度学习:Anaconda集成了常用的机器学习和深度学习库,如Scikit-learn、TensorFlow和PyTorch,可以用于构建和训练机器学习模型。
  3. 科学计算和数值计算:Anaconda包含了许多科学计算和数值计算库,如NumPy和SciPy,可以进行数值计算、优化和模拟等科学计算任务。
  4. Web开发和应用部署:Anaconda可以作为Python的开发环境,用于开发Web应用和部署应用到服务器上。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用部署。详情请参考:https://cloud.tencent.com/product/cvm
  2. 腾讯云容器服务(TKE):提供容器化应用的管理和部署,支持Kubernetes。详情请参考:https://cloud.tencent.com/product/tke
  3. 腾讯云对象存储(COS):提供高可靠、低成本的对象存储服务,适用于大规模数据存储和备份。详情请参考:https://cloud.tencent.com/product/cos
  4. 腾讯云人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持图像识别、语音识别、自然语言处理等任务。详情请参考:https://cloud.tencent.com/product/ailab
  5. 腾讯云区块链服务(BCS):提供简单易用的区块链部署和管理服务,支持多种区块链框架。详情请参考:https://cloud.tencent.com/product/bcs

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券